Analysis of the 2nd Log4j CVE published earlier (CVE-2021-45046 / Log4Shell2)
I'm sure they mean well, but I'd highly recommend to every user to be very careful about using services like this.
Do you know whether you can trust them? Is their operations mature enough for handling the attacks they are guaranteed to receive? After all, a system receiving requests by folks suspecting they are vulnerable, makes a highly attractive target itself. In fact, I wouldn't be surprised if we see services of this kind provided by malicious actors.
Really, people should just update, or only use offline tools for analysis and mitigation like [1] which they can audit and run locally.
